Why Build Your Own UTV? The Benefits and Challenges
Before diving into the nuts and bolts, let’s assess if building a UTV is right for you. The advantages are compelling. You gain complete customization – tailoring the machine to your specific needs and terrain. Cost savings can be realized, though this isn’t always guaranteed (more on that later). And, of course, there’s the immense pride of ownership and the learning experience. However, it’s not without its hurdles.
- Complexity: This is a complex project requiring significant mechanical skill and knowledge.
- Time Commitment: Expect to invest hundreds of hours.
- Cost: Parts can be expensive, and unexpected issues can inflate the budget.
- Legal Compliance: Ensuring your build meets safety standards and is street-legal (if desired) can be challenging.
- Warranty: You’re responsible for all repairs and maintenance – no manufacturer warranty applies.
If you’re comfortable with these challenges, let’s move forward. Consider starting with a simpler project, like restoring an existing ATV, before tackling a full build your own 4 wheeler project.
Planning Your UTV Build: Defining Your Needs
Successful builds start with meticulous planning. Don’t just start ordering parts! First, define the primary purpose of your UTV. Will it be used for work, recreation, hunting, or a combination? This will dictate key specifications.
Key Considerations for UTV Design
- Terrain: Rocky mountains, muddy trails, sandy dunes – the terrain dictates tire size, suspension travel, and ground clearance.
- Load Capacity: How much weight will you need to carry? This impacts the frame, engine, and suspension choices.
- Passenger Capacity: Single-seater, two-seater, or more?
- Engine Type: Gasoline, diesel, or even electric? Each has pros and cons regarding power, fuel efficiency, and maintenance.
- Budget: Be realistic. A complete UTV build can easily exceed the cost of a factory-built model if you’re not careful.

Essential Components: What You’ll Need to Build a 4 Wheeler
Here’s a breakdown of the core components required to build a UTV. You can purchase complete kits or source parts individually.
- Frame: The foundation of your UTV. Kits are available in various configurations.
- Engine: Typically a single or twin-cylinder gasoline engine, ranging from 300cc to 800cc or larger. Electric options are becoming increasingly popular.
- Transmission: CVT (Continuously Variable Transmission) is the most common choice for UTVs.
- Suspension: Independent suspension (A-arms) is preferred for comfort and performance.
- Steering: Rack and pinion steering is typical.
- Brakes: Hydraulic disc brakes are essential for safety.
- Wheels and Tires: Choose tires appropriate for your intended terrain.
- Body Panels: Protect the components and provide a finished look.
- Electrical System: Wiring harness, battery, lights, and instrumentation.
- Safety Equipment: Roll cage, seat belts, and potentially a winch.
Sourcing quality parts is paramount. Reputable suppliers include those specializing in ATV/UTV parts and performance upgrades. Don’t skimp on safety-critical components like brakes and steering.
The Assembly Process: Step-by-Step Guide
The assembly process will vary depending on whether you’re using a kit or sourcing parts individually. However, here’s a general outline:
- Frame Assembly: Follow the kit instructions carefully. Ensure all welds are strong and secure.
- Engine Installation: Mount the engine to the frame and connect the transmission.
- Suspension Installation: Install the A-arms, shocks, and springs.
- Steering Installation: Connect the steering rack and linkage.
- Brake Installation: Install the brake calipers, rotors, and lines.
- Electrical System Installation: Wire the harness, connect the battery, and install the lights and instrumentation.
- Body Panel Installation: Attach the body panels to the frame.
- Final Checks: Thoroughly inspect all connections and ensure everything is functioning correctly.
Take your time and double-check your work at each stage. Consult online forums and resources for guidance. Consider having a qualified mechanic inspect your build before hitting the trails.
Safety First: Essential Considerations for Your DIY UTV
Safety is non-negotiable. A poorly built UTV can be dangerous. Here are some critical safety considerations:
- Roll Cage: A robust roll cage is essential to protect occupants in the event of a rollover.
- Seat Belts: Always wear seat belts.
- Helmet: Wear a DOT-approved helmet at all times.
- Brake System: Ensure the brakes are functioning flawlessly.
- Steering System: Verify the steering is responsive and accurate.
- Electrical System: Properly insulate all wiring to prevent shorts and fires.
- Regular Maintenance: Perform regular maintenance checks to identify and address potential issues.

Legal Considerations: Registration and Street Legality
Before you ride, understand the legal requirements in your state. Many states require UTVs to be registered, even for off-road use. Street legality varies significantly by state. Some states allow UTVs on certain roads with specific modifications (lights, turn signals, mirrors, etc.). Check with your state’s Department of Motor Vehicles (DMV) for specific regulations.

Maintaining Your Custom UTV
Once you’ve successfully build your own 4 wheeler, regular maintenance is crucial to keep it running smoothly. Follow the manufacturer’s recommendations for oil changes, filter replacements, and other maintenance tasks. Inspect the machine regularly for wear and tear. Address any issues promptly to prevent them from escalating.
Maintenance Checklist
| Task | Frequency |
|---|---|
| Oil Change | Every 50-100 hours of operation |
| Air Filter Cleaning/Replacement | Every 25-50 hours of operation |
| Tire Pressure Check | Before each ride |
| Brake Pad Inspection | Every 100 hours of operation |
| Chain/Belt Inspection | Every 50 hours of operation |
